Fine-Tuning Product Regimens for Warmer Days


Among one of the most effective ways to refresh a skincare protocol is by rethinking the products your clients use daily. As temperatures rise, hefty occlusive items might no longer serve them well. Consider recommending lighter hydration and switching from abundant creams to gel-based or water-based choices.


Cleansing is an additional essential area where refined adjustments can make a substantial distinction. In the spring, the skin may generate even more oil and sweat, particularly with enhanced activity and time outdoors. Recommend balancing cleansers that support the skin obstacle while completely eliminating impurities. Urge customers to avoid harsh removing products, which can cause even more oil production and level of sensitivity.


Naturally, SPF is non-negotiable year-round, but springtime is a suitable time to double down on sunlight protection. With longer daytime hours and more time invested outside, a broad-spectrum SPF ought to become part of every morning regimen. Offer customers options that really feel lightweight and breathable to sustain daily wear.

Resolving Seasonal Skin Stressors Head-On


Springtime isn't simply sunlight and roses. It likewise brings seasonal allergies, enhanced pollen, and a greater chance of irritability or flare-ups. As an aggressive skincare professional, anticipate these concerns and construct preventative procedures into your customer procedures.


Search for signs of animated skin, such as inflammation, dryness, or itching, particularly in clients susceptible to seasonal allergies. Concentrate on soothing ingredients and obstacle support. Suggest lifestyle adjustments, such as washing the face after being outdoors, to lower allergen direct exposure.


Hydration stays crucial, also as moisture increases. Yet hydration doesn't need to mean hefty. Urge the use of hydrating hazes, lotions with hyaluronic acid, and light-weight lotions that take in promptly while keeping the skin plump.
